Pele Posted December 1, 2005 Posted December 1, 2005 I'll be along if I can get a babysitter for Jake Also for those that haven't been to a rally before - make sure you have plenty of warm clothing - especially socks, your feet get freezing standing around lol - and if you think you are standing far enough away from the track, take a few more steps back - I got hit by a stone and it was a very painful experience.... And.... Please take notice of what the marshals tell you, they are ony doing their job at the end of the day and that is to keep you and the drivers safe - the smoother they can keep things running and the faster they can clear any accidents that happen means everone gets to go home at a sensible time.... calder Posted December 8, 2005 Posted December 8, 2005 "Please take notice of what the marshals tell you, they are ony doing their job at the end of the day and that is to keep you and the drivers safe - the smoother they can keep things running and the faster they can clear any accidents that happen means everone gets to go home at a sensible time.... " good advice indeed although for those of you that haven't been to Rockinham before its an all seater stadium inside. I think the only bit that you could stand next to is the bit thats shown going out of the paddock entrance into the outside car park on the stage map - this does seem to be quite a bit. (bottom left corner of diagram). The competitor access tunnel (the bit above) has a sign over it saying "exhaust appreciation tunnel" hope you enjoy it. This tunnel is how competitors vehicles get in and out under the sw grandstand. There's probably no camping on the site - although i wouldn't fancy camping at this time of year. I did pitch a tent in the paddock back in May but this was competitors only. There is a nice inn about 2 miles down the road, sorry can't remember the name. Rockingham has to be the most impressive stadium venue in the UK - it must be easily four times bigger than any football stadium, it's enormous. Only downside is that for such a big venue which must have cost millions the showers are sh!te! hth richard
